Invest Bangladesh Chairman Ashiq Chowdhury given the status of State Minister


Published: 01:08 26 August 2026
The government has given the status of State Minister to Invest Bangladesh Authority Chairman Chowdhury Ashiq Mahmud Bin Harun (Ashiq Chowdhury). The decision will be effective immediately, the notification issued by the Cabinet Division on Tuesday (August 25) said.
Ashiq Chowdhury gets the status of State Minister
The notification said that Ashiq Chowdhury will receive the salary, allowances and other benefits applicable to a State Minister while serving as the Chairman of the Invest Bangladesh Authority.
The government's decision has been taken to support the Chairman in carrying out his duties as well as to further strengthen the activities of the Invest Bangladesh Authority in investment development and facilitation.

Role of Invest Bangladesh in investment promotion
The Invest Bangladesh Authority, which operates under the Prime Minister's Office, works to attract domestic and foreign investment in the country. At the same time, the organization also plays an important role in coordinating various investment-related services and initiatives.
Invest Bangladesh's activities are considered important in facilitating the investment environment and ensuring the necessary services for investors more effectively.
